Market Context and Implications
The global fluorspar market, a key raw material for the fluorine industry, is experiencing heightened demand due to its critical role in producing hydrofluoric acid, which is essential for manufacturing a range of products from refrigerants to lithium-ion batteries. China’s dominance in the fluorspar market, accounting for over 60% of global production, provides it with substantial leverage over industries dependent on these materials.
One of the crucial factors contributing to China’s dominance is its vast reserves and well-established mining infrastructure. The country’s ability to produce high-quality fluorspar at scale has enabled it to meet not only domestic demands but also export requirements, thereby reinforcing its position as a key player in the global supply chain.
Moreover, China’s strategic investment in fluorine-related technology and production facilities has further consolidated its role. This includes advancements in refining processes and innovations in fluorine applications, which have broadened the scope of industries relying on Chinese fluorspar. As a result, the global market is increasingly influenced by China’s production trends and policy decisions.
Strategic Implications for Global Industries
China’s fluorspar industry plays a critical role in several high-tech industries, including electronics, renewable energy, and pharmaceuticals. For instance, the increasing demand for electric vehicles (EVs) and the corresponding need for lithium-ion batteries underscore the importance of stable fluorspar supplies. China’s ability to control fluorspar availability can directly impact the production costs and supply chain stability for EV manufacturers globally.
In the electronics sector, hydrofluoric acid, derived from fluorspar, is crucial for semiconductor manufacturing. As global demand for semiconductors continues to rise, any disruptions in fluorspar supply could have significant ramifications for technology companies worldwide. Additionally, the pharmaceutical industry relies on fluorine compounds for developing various medications, further emphasizing the strategic importance of fluorspar.
Recent data from market analysts suggest that the global fluorspar market is expected to grow at a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of approximately 4.5% over the next five years. This growth trajectory highlights the increasing reliance on fluorspar across multiple sectors and the potential vulnerabilities associated with supply concentration in China.
